<RecipeText>CAKE INGREDIENTS
:
: 1 box spice or German chocolate cake mix
: 1 box of white cake mix
: 1 package white sandwich cookies
: 1 large package vanilla instant pudding mix
: A few drops green food coloring
: 12 small Tootsie Rolls or equivalent
:
: SERVING &quot;DISHES AND UTENSILS&quot;
:
: 1 NEW cat-litter box
: 1 NEW cat-litter box liner
: 1 NEW pooper scooper
:
: Prepare and bake cake mixes, according to directions, in any
: size pan. Prepare pudding and chill. Crumble cookies in small
: batches in blender or food processor.
: Add a few drops of green food coloring to 1 cup of cookie
: crumbs. Mix with a fork or shake in a jar. Set aside.
: When cakes are at room temperature, crumble them into a large
: bowl. Toss with half of the remaining cookie crumbs and enough
: pudding to make the mixture moist but not soggy. Place liner in
: litter box and pour in mixture.
: Unwrap 3 Tootsie Rolls and heat in a microwave until soft and
: pliable. Shape the blunt ends into slightly curved points.
: Repeat with three more rolls. Bury the rolls decoratively in the cake
: mixture.
: Sprinkle remaining white cookie crumbs over the mixture, then
: scatter green crumbs lightly over top.
: Heat 5 more Tootsie Rolls until almost melted. Scrape them on
: top of the cake and sprinkle with crumbs from the litter box.
: Heat the remaining Tootsie Roll until pliable and hang it over the
edge
: of the box.
: Place box on a sheet of newspaper and serve with scooper.
